About this cruise

The kind of trip that's easy to say yes to and hard to regret. 7 nights from Naples on April 27, 2026, visiting Messina, Valletta, Barcelona, Marseille and Genoa. Expect a run of consecutive ports, 5 stops total, with the busiest days packed close together. The sea days around them feel earned. It's a proper Western Mediterranean tour: 4 countries, from Italy to France. Keep an eye out for Messina: Sicily's gateway to Mount Etna and Taormina. Roughly 9 hours ashore per stop. No need to rush. From casual buffets to proper sit-down restaurants, MSC World Europa has 9 dining spots on board, most of them included. And April is a good time to go. Mild weather, things starting to bloom, and fewer people than summer. That's 7 nights well spent.
